A snarky comedy filled with lustful vengeance, infinitely and relationship mishaps. That, exactly what 'The Players'  is. Coming to Netflix this mid-July, it is the Italian remake of the 2012 film of the same name. The original title for the remake is 'Gli Infedeli' and the trailer seems to a stressful one, as many women find out about the secrets of their significant other. Here is what we know of the upcoming release.

Release date

'The Players' releases on July 15, 2020.

Plot

The official synopsis reads, "From unconventional deceives to provocative amazements, this assortment of vignettes catches the imprudences of a few men as they bungle with loyalty and connections. Five stories, five episodes and one big theme: Betrayal in love."

Cast

Riccardo Scamarcio as Lorenzo

(Vittorio Zunino Celotto/Getty Images)

Scamarcio, an actor and producer, is known for his roles as Santino D'Antonio in 'John Wick: Chapter 2' (2017), Tommaso Cantone in 'Loose Cannons' (2010), Step in 'Three Steps Over Heaven' (2004) and Il Nero in 'Romanzo CriminaleIl' (2005). According to the actor's IMDb page, he is part of two other projects that are in post-production — 'Three Floors' and 'Il legame', and two in pre-production — 'L'ultimo paradiso' and 'L'ombra del Caravaggio'.

Valerio Mastandrea as Favini

(Vittorio Zunino Celotto/Getty Images)

Mastandrea is also an actor and producer, known for his roles as Lele in 'Perfect Strangers' (2016), Giulioin in 'Balancing Act' (2012) and De Rossi in 'Nine' (2009.) His producer credits include 'Laughing' (2018), 'Fiore' (2016), 'My Class' (2013), and an oldie 'Good Morning, Aman' (2009).

Other members of the cast include, Ascanio Balboas Rudi, Laura Chiatti, Valentina Cervi, Marina Foïs and many more.

Creators

Stefano Mordini serves as director, while Filippo Bologna, Stefano Mordini, and Riccardo Scamarcio serve as writers. The movie is produced by 102 Distribution, HT Film, Indigo Film, Lebowski and Rai Cinema.
